Business intelligence analyst
Posted: 2 March
Offer description

Are you an analytical problem-solver with a passion for transforming data into meaningful insight? Do you enjoy working independently while collaborating across teams to drive data-informed decision-making? BSN Social Care is looking for a detail-oriented Business Intelligence Developer to join our growing team.

This is an exciting opportunity for someone with 2–5 years' experience to work closely alongside our Business Intelligence Manager, contributing to the development and enhancement of BI solutions across multiple systems. You will play an important role in ensuring high-quality, reliable data supports strategic and operational decisions across the organisation.

What You'll Be Doing
:

Design, develop, and maintain robust Power BI dashboards, reports, and data models using a star schema approach, managing the full lifecycle through to deployment and end-user guidance.

Create and optimise DAX measures and calculated columns to deliver accurate and insightful reporting.

Analyse data to uncover trends, patterns, and opportunities for improvement.

Work closely with stakeholders across departments to gather clear requirements, asking the right questions to fully understand business needs.

Present and deliver reports to senior leadership and executive teams in a clear and accessible manner.

Translate complex technical requirements into language and insights that non-technical stakeholders can understand.

Regularly review reports and exception data to maintain the highest data quality standards, identifying discrepancies and coordinating with relevant teams to resolve issues.

Support ongoing improvements in data processes, automation, and reporting efficiency.

Document processes, report logic, and data definitions to ensure transparency and consistency.

Stay up-to-date with BI tools, Microsoft technologies, and industry best practices.

What We're Looking For:
2–5 years' experience in a Business Intelligence or data-focused role.

A degree in Data, Maths, Computer Science, Statistics or equivalent practical experience.

Strong experience with the Microsoft stack, particularly SQL, Power BI, and Excel (essential).

Proven experience designing and building Power BI data models or relational databases using a star schema methodology.

Strong working knowledge of DAX, Role Level Security and report deployment best practices.

Solid understanding of GDPR and handling sensitive data appropriately.

Experience ensuring data integrity and maintaining high data quality standards.

Ability to manage personal projects independently while contributing effectively to team initiatives.

Confident communicator with experience liaising with multiple departments and senior stakeholders.

Strong analytical and logical mindset with excellent attention to detail.

A natural problem-solver who enjoys digging into data to identify root causes and improvements.
